Graphics primitives ------------------- Here are all of the simple shapes you can draw: .. autosummary:: :toctree: api/generated/ cone cylinder line point sphere text triangle trinorm Manipulating graphics primitives -------------------------------- .. autosummary:: :toctree: api/generated/ listall replace delete info Changing the style of graphics ------------------------------ VMD draws graphics in a "stack" of commands that are applied in order. Instead of setting the material or color for individual graphics primitives, the color or material is defined as a command put on the stack, then all subsequent primitives will be drawn with that style until a new color or material is set. .. autosummary:: :toctree: api/generated/ color material materials The following code will draw a red cylinder, then a blue sphere: .. code-block:: python from vmd import molecule, graphics drawmol = molecule.new(name="Drawings") graphics.color(drawmol, 1) cylinder_id = graphics.cylinder(drawmol, (0,0,0), (0,1,0), filled=True) graphics.color(drawmol, 0) sphere_id = graphics.sphere(drawmol, (0,0,0), radius=0.3)
